聚查查和聚链通

我要开发同款
EdwardNewgate2022年11月19日
204阅读

作品详情

项目名称:聚查查项 目 链 接 : www.juchacha.cn项目描述:企业数据搜索服务项目模块:平台开发,数据导出技术描述: Python+Flask+Vue+Mysql+Redis+Nginx+UWSGI+Elasticsearch责任描述:搭建数据采集,数据加工,数据可视化支持1、为公司及分公司商务团队提供数据可视化支持2、根据多项目业务需求进行技术迭代开发项目名称:聚链通项 目 链 接 : links.321tops.com项目描述:聚集海外博客网站,为客户提供外链发布服务 项目模块:平台对接,文章模块对接,技术描述: Python+Django+Flask+Vue+Mysql+Redis+Celery+Nginx+UWSGI+Selenium责任描述:对接网站成功率,进程管理,服务器管理1、使用 Django 框架部署后端业务逻辑,使用 VUE 框架+ element 部署前端业务逻辑,使用 flask 框架部署海外服务器,实现 shocket 接收 json 信息完成项目的业务逻辑。2、使用 celery+redis 集群分布式部署任务队列,实现 selenium 自动化对接海外平台的业务逻辑,部署Celery 堆中的 revoke 方法,实现根据 task_id 获取 celery 里的 task 即将执行的 func 函数对象,以 python 的垃圾回收机制里面的引用计数法,将该对象 delete 掉离开作用域,优化了在不更改 redis缓存队列的情况下,保持队列正常执行 task_func 不执行。3、后端 django 框架使用 orm 进行对象化数据库交互防止 sql 注入,海外服务器使用 flask 部署由于开启防火墙后开放接收后端端口,限制了内网 ip 请求和服务器 ip 无客户端交互,所以在数据库交互上使用了原始 sql 语句进行快速查询入库。4、使用 DFA 算法,对客户发布文章进行敏感词过滤。5、实现序列化 user 表对象,根据表字段值的不同对用户进行权限划分,优化了后端框架路由的代码量和减少了数据库查询的量。6、自建站 docker 容器管理,使用布隆过滤器筛选文章是否存在。
查看全文
声明:本文仅代表作者观点,不代表本站立场。如果侵犯到您的合法权益,请联系我们删除侵权资源!如果遇到资源链接失效,请您通过评论或工单的方式通知管理员。未经允许,不得转载,本站所有资源文章禁止商业使用运营!
下载安装【程序员客栈】APP
实时对接需求、及时收发消息、丰富的开放项目需求、随时随地查看项目状态

评论